This is a review of the LK Chen Scarlet Sunrise Jian which was very kindly sent for study and review. Based on original surviving artifacts from the Jin dynasty, this is a light weight, narrow bladed sword which still can cut and thrust very effectively. It is very nicely finished, and has fittings that have interesting implications for European sword history...

Uni comes first. =) I've stumbled onto scabbard slides, as they have been the (functional) part which has been adopted most obviously in cultures across the Steppe, and into eastern Europe. There is some indication that the Warring state->Han dynasty 'Disk pommels' were also adopted/adapted as far as Bactria and perhaps towards the Capsian sea. Even the finds that I showed in the video suggest Chinese influence in their pommels in my estimation. I would like to study cross guards more thoroughly on some of these finds attributed even to Hunnic swords...
